Welcome back to another exciting episode of Real Talk with Rachel Awtrey, where we bring you insightful conversations with experts and thought leaders on topics that matter to families. Today, we have a very special guest, Sissy Goff, a counselor at Daystar Counseling Ministries, who dedicates her life to helping families and children navigate the challenges of anxiety and worry. In this episode, Sissy shares her wealth of knowledge on calming strategies for children, explores why anxiety can be contagious, and offers valuable advice on becoming worry-free parents.

Meet Our Guest: Sissy Goff

Sissy Goff is a renowned counselor with over twenty-five years of experience in child and family counseling. She’s a licensed professional counselor, author, and sought-after speaker who has made it her mission to support families in their journey towards emotional well-being. As a part of Daystar Counseling Ministries, Sissy is passionate about helping children and parents thrive, even in the face of anxiety and worry. Calming Strategies for Children

One of the key topics we delve into in this episode is the importance of calming strategies for children. Sissy Goff emphasizes that teaching children how to manage their emotions and anxiety from a young age is essential for their overall well-being. She provides practical insights into helping children cope with anxiety and stress, such as deep breathing exercises, mindfulness techniques, and the importance of creating a safe and nurturing environment at home.

Sissy also discusses the role of creativity and play in helping children express and process their emotions. Her insights on these calming strategies can be invaluable for parents and caregivers looking to support their children in managing anxiety.

Why Anxiety is Contagious

An intriguing aspect of our conversation with Sissy is her explanation of why anxiety can be contagious within families. She highlights how children often pick up on their parents’ or caregivers’ emotions and behaviors. This means that if parents are anxious or constantly worrying, their children are likely to absorb these feelings and behaviors, potentially leading to increased anxiety in the younger generation.

Sissy offers guidance on breaking this cycle and fostering an emotionally healthy home environment. She shares tips on how parents can model healthy emotional responses and cultivate an atmosphere of trust and open communication within the family.

Becoming Worry-Free Parents

Our conversation with Sissy wouldn’t be complete without addressing the topic of how parents can become worry-free themselves. In today’s fast-paced world, it’s easy for parents to become overwhelmed by their own anxieties and concerns. Sissy offers valuable advice on self-care, setting boundaries, and seeking support when needed. She emphasizes that when parents prioritize their own well-being, they are better equipped to support their children effectively.
